Performance

The results that we've achieved are difficult to interpret because they have no real correlation to the actual specs of each system. There should be no way that a Pentium III should be running twenty percent slower than an Athlon system running at the same clock speed. Both the Winstone and the BAPco results show this so there's no real argument. The probable cause for this is a question mark over the hard drive and memory in the Avanti rather than a general fault with these types of systems.

Figure 2. shows the Protek machine way out in front on the Winstone results which agrees with Figure 3., the SYSmark 2000 benchmark. Where they differ is mainly for the Big Red machine, putting it equal with the Protek under SYSmark and still behind under Winstone. Equally the Big Red is all over the place with only 64mg in it as well if we're comparing the results. The only real explanation to this is that BAPco isn't as reliant on the Hard Drive as Winstone. Figure 5. definitely shows that the Big Red has got a problem compared to the Protek, but unfortunately we were unable to get a result out of the Avanti. A Disk Winbench of 4530 is very good but about right for machines of this kind of specification.

Figure 4. shows the CPU Winbench results, which again yields very strange answers. The Avanti is WELL below what it should be which may explain the poor overall benchmarks but we were unable to get the machine to complete the Winbench tests properly so that result may be unreliable.

Figure 1. gives the 3D Mark 2000 results which again shows a large difference between the machines with the same video card. The Big Red machine wouldn't give us a proper result, but we did get a result of 1690 which is again well below what should be expected.

What is clear is that the Ultra MX ran away with all the results, giving a very quick machine for the configuration.
